(глупый вопрос) eix-0.25.5 - исправляем "чтеНЬЕ, построеНЬЕ итд" (правильно ли я правил ru.po?)

Sabayon, Calculate, Funtoo, Exherbo

Модератор: /dev/random

Ответить
Аватара пользователя
kastian
Сообщения: 8
ОС: Gentoo

(глупый вопрос) eix-0.25.5 - исправляем "чтеНЬЕ, построеНЬЕ итд"

Сообщение kastian »

Всем привет.

Не считайте мень grammar-nazi, но честно говоря, слегка достало видеть в консоли

Код: Выделить всё

ЧтенЬе настроек Portage ..
ПостроенЬе базы данных (/var/cache/eix/portage.eix)

В принципе, в следующих версиях сие уже поправили, но размаскировывать без особой нужды - не уверен, что это правильно

Соответственно, что было сделано (при посильной помощи инструкции с http://hakushka.wordpress.com/2010/02/24/e...o-style-patch/)

Код: Выделить всё

ebuild /usr/portage/app-portage/eix/eix-0.25.5.ebuild unpack

дальше правка /var/tmp/portage/app-portage/eix-0.25.5/work/eix-0.25.5/po/ru.po

Код: Выделить всё

gmsgfmt ru.po -o ru.gmo
ebuild /usr/portage/app-portage/eix/eix-0.25.5.ebuild compile
ebuild /usr/portage/app-portage/eix/eix-0.25.5.ebuild install
ebuild /usr/portage/app-portage/eix/eix-0.25.5.ebuild qmerge

Проверил - вроде как все нормально, работает (тьфу-тьфу-тьфу).

Вопрос - не сделал ли я что-то неправильно?
Заранее спасибо.
people are strange
when you're a stranger
Спасибо сказали:
Аватара пользователя
/dev/random
Администратор
Сообщения: 5282
ОС: Gentoo

Re: (глупый вопрос) eix-0.25.5 - исправляем "чтеНЬЕ, построеНЬЕ итд"

Сообщение /dev/random »

Неправильно, но не очень.

То, что вы сделали - на один раз. Если portage пересоберёт eix (например, из-за изменившихся флагов), всё вернётся как было.
Если делать как положено, то нужно создать патч, скопировать ебилд в локальный оверлей и т.д.

Во всём остальном - правильно.
Спасибо сказали:
Аватара пользователя
megabaks
Сообщения: 697
ОС: Gentoo ~x86
Контактная информация:

Re: (глупый вопрос) eix-0.25.5 - исправляем "чтеНЬЕ, построеНЬЕ итд"

Сообщение megabaks »

/dev/random писал(а):
11.04.2013 15:56
Если делать как положено, то нужно создать патч, скопировать ебилд в локальный оверлей и т.д.

ничего подобного!
никакого локального оверлея не нужно
http://megabaks.blogspot.ru/2012/10/portage.html

кстати, это только в допотопной версии
в актуальной нормально

Код: Выделить всё

>>> Updating Portage cache
100% [=======================================================================>]
 * Запуск eix-update
Чтение настроек Portage ..
Построение базы данных (/var/cache/eix/portage.eix) ..
[0] "gentoo" /usr/portage/ (кэш: sqlite)
     Чтение Пакетов .. Готово
[1] "stuff" /usr/local/portage/layman/stuff (кэш: parse|ebuild*#metadata-md5#metadata-flat#assign)
     Чтение категории 159|159 (100%) Готово
[2] "rion" /usr/local/portage/layman/rion (кэш: parse|ebuild*#metadata-md5#metadata-flat#assign)
     Чтение категории 159|159 (100%) Готово
Применение масок ..
Расчёт хеш-таблиц ..
Запись файла базы данных /var/cache/eix/portage.eix ..
База данных содержит 16459 пакетов в 159 категориях.
Спасибо сказали:
Аватара пользователя
kastian
Сообщения: 8
ОС: Gentoo

Re: (глупый вопрос) eix-0.25.5 - исправляем "чтеНЬЕ, построеНЬЕ итд"

Сообщение kastian »

/dev/random писал(а):
11.04.2013 15:56
Во всём остальном - правильно.

Собсственно, остальное больше всего и волновало. Благодарю, учту)

megabaks писал(а):
12.04.2013 03:33
кстати, это только в допотопной версии
в актуальной нормально

Код: Выделить всё

[05:24]$ eix eix
[I] app-portage/eix
     Available versions:  0.23.10 0.25.5 ~0.27.4 ~0.27.6 ~0.28.2 ~0.28.3 {{clang debug +dep doc linguas_de linguas_ru nls optimization security sqlite strong-optimization strong-security swap-remote tools zsh-completion}}
     Installed versions:  0.25.5

[05:25]$ eselect profile list
Available profile symlink targets:
  [1]   default/linux/x86/13.0 *

пардон, а что считается актуальной?
people are strange
when you're a stranger
Спасибо сказали:
Аватара пользователя
megabaks
Сообщения: 697
ОС: Gentoo ~x86
Контактная информация:

Re: (глупый вопрос) eix-0.25.5 - исправляем "чтеНЬЕ, построеНЬЕ итд"

Сообщение megabaks »

актуальная - это 0.27 и дальше
а ежели попробуешь воспользоваться eix-remote, то с 0.25 получишь фейл
не стоит тупо надеяться на мейнтанеров - они должны уже овер пару месяцев как стабилизировать 27-ю версию, но тормозят как обычно.
думай своей головой, а не надейся на тормозов
Спасибо сказали:
Ответить